How to implement a cybersecurity framework?

Implementing a cybersecurity framework in an organization involves several phases. Firstly, the management team must define the scope and objectives of the framework. Then, a risk assessment must be conducted to identify the potential threats and vulnerabilities that can impact the organization. Based on the assessment, a set of policies and procedures should be developed to mitigate the risks. Next, the framework should be communicated to all the employees and awareness training should be provided. Continuous monitoring and evaluation is an important aspect of the framework to ensure its effectiveness and to make necessary improvements. Finally, periodic reviews must be conducted to assess the effectiveness of the framework and to address new risks and threats. The implementation of a cybersecurity framework must be a collaborative effort from all employees to ensure the protection of the organization's assets and information.
